Design Thinking courses can help you learn user-centered design, prototyping, brainstorming techniques, and iterative testing. You can build skills in empathy mapping, defining user personas, and conducting usability tests. Many courses introduce tools like Adobe XD, Figma, and Miro, which facilitate collaboration and visualization throughout the design process. Additionally, you'll explore methods for gathering feedback and refining solutions, ensuring that your designs are not only innovative but also aligned with user needs.
